Home
last modified time | relevance | path

Searched refs:eht_gi (Results 1 – 14 of 14) sorted by relevance

/linux/net/wireless/
H A Dutil.c1611 if (WARN_ON_ONCE(rate->eht_gi > NL80211_RATE_INFO_EHT_GI_3_2)) in _cfg80211_calculate_bitrate_eht_uhr()
1638 result = 4 * rates_996[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1641 result = 3 * rates_996[rate->eht_gi] + rates_484[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1644 result = 3 * rates_996[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1647 result = 2 * rates_996[rate->eht_gi] + rates_484[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1651 result = 2 * rates_996[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1655 result = rates_996[rate->eht_gi] + rates_484[rate->eht_gi] in _cfg80211_calculate_bitrate_eht_uhr()
1656 + rates_242[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1659 result = rates_996[rate->eht_gi] + rates_484[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
1663 result = rates_996[rate->eht_gi]; in _cfg80211_calculate_bitrate_eht_uhr()
[all …]
H A Dnl80211.c5802 mask->control[i].eht_gi = 0xFF; in nl80211_parse_tx_bitrate_mask()
5882 mask->control[band].eht_gi = in nl80211_parse_tx_bitrate_mask()
7263 if (nla_put_u8(msg, NL80211_RATE_INFO_EHT_GI, info->eht_gi)) in nl80211_put_sta_rate()
7274 if (nla_put_u8(msg, NL80211_RATE_INFO_EHT_GI, info->eht_gi)) in nl80211_put_sta_rate()
/linux/drivers/net/wireless/mediatek/mt76/mt7925/
H A Dmac.c128 rate->eht_gi = FIELD_GET(GENMASK(25, 24), val); in mt7925_mac_sta_poll()
985 rate.eht_gi = wcid->rate.eht_gi; in mt7925_mac_add_txs_skb()
/linux/net/mac80211/
H A Dairtime.c655 stat->eht.gi = ri->eht_gi; in ieee80211_fill_rate_info()
H A Dsta_info.c2567 rinfo->eht_gi = STA_STATS_GET(EHT_GI, rate); in sta_stats_decode_rate()
2574 rinfo->eht_gi = STA_STATS_GET(UHR_GI, rate); in sta_stats_decode_rate()
/linux/drivers/net/wireless/ath/ath12k/
H A Dmac.c12727 u8 eht_gi, u8 eht_ltf, in ath12k_mac_set_rate_params() argument
12756 eht_gi, eht_ltf, eht_fixed_rate); in ath12k_mac_set_rate_params()
12789 ret = ath12k_mac_set_fixed_rate_gi_ltf(arvif, eht_gi, eht_ltf, in ath12k_mac_set_rate_params()
12792 ret = ath12k_mac_set_auto_rate_gi_ltf(arvif, eht_gi, eht_ltf); in ath12k_mac_set_rate_params()
12797 eht_gi, eht_ltf, ret); in ath12k_mac_set_rate_params()
13043 u8 eht_ltf = 0, eht_gi = 0; in ath12k_mac_op_set_bitrate_mask() local
13080 eht_gi = mask->control[band].eht_gi; in ath12k_mac_op_set_bitrate_mask()
13196 he_ltf, he_fixed_rate, eht_gi, eht_ltf, in ath12k_mac_op_set_bitrate_mask()
13445 sinfo->txrate.eht_gi = rate_info.txrate.eht_gi; in ath12k_mac_op_sta_statistics()
13557 link_sinfo->txrate.eht_gi = peer->txrate.eht_gi; in ath12k_mac_op_link_sta_statistics()
H A Ddp_htt.c322 peer->txrate.eht_gi = ath12k_mac_eht_gi_to_nl80211_eht_gi(sgi); in ath12k_update_per_peer_tx_stats()
/linux/drivers/net/wireless/mediatek/mt76/mt7996/
H A Dmain.c1676 sinfo->txrate.eht_gi = txrate->eht_gi; in mt7996_sta_statistics()
H A Dmac.c1550 rate.eht_gi = wcid->rate.eht_gi; in mt7996_mac_add_txs_skb()
H A Dmcu.c558 rate->eht_gi = mcu_rate->tx_gi; in mt7996_mcu_update_tx_gi()
/linux/include/net/
H A Dcfg80211.h883 enum nl80211_eht_gi eht_gi; member
2030 u8 eht_gi; member
/linux/drivers/net/wireless/realtek/rtw89/
H A Dphy.c300 gi = mask->control[nl_band].eht_gi; in rtw89_phy_ra_gi_ltf()
3278 ra_report->txrate.eht_gi = NL80211_RATE_INFO_EHT_GI_0_8; in __rtw89_phy_c2h_ra_rpt_iter()
3280 ra_report->txrate.eht_gi = NL80211_RATE_INFO_EHT_GI_1_6; in __rtw89_phy_c2h_ra_rpt_iter()
3282 ra_report->txrate.eht_gi = NL80211_RATE_INFO_EHT_GI_3_2; in __rtw89_phy_c2h_ra_rpt_iter()
H A Ddebug.c3907 rate->eht_gi < ARRAY_SIZE(eht_gi_str) ? in rtw89_sta_link_info_get_iter()
3908 eht_gi_str[rate->eht_gi] : "N/A"); in rtw89_sta_link_info_get_iter()
/linux/drivers/net/wireless/virtual/
H A Dmac80211_hwsim.c3741 rate_info->eht_gi = nla_get_u8(tb[HWSIM_RATE_INFO_ATTR_EHT_GI]); in mac80211_hwsim_parse_rate_info()